Restorative Justice 2-Day Workshop: Deepening Connection & Facilitating Transformation Through Restorative Practices & Restorative Justice (9/30/17-10/1/17, 9AM-5PM)
Practices To Connect  Justice To Restore & Transform

Pam Orbach, Empowering Connection
Andrea Brenneke, Heart Justice

Are you seeking

- Deeper connection and belonging in your communities, organizations, families, workplaces, schools/universities, activist and faith groups?
- Increased capacity to engage from the heart and transform conflict?
- Tangible ways to promote racial equity and alternatives to systems of oppression?

Are you longing for justice that
- Addresses harm and promotes belonging
- Meets individual and community needs
- Empowers voice and action
- Enhances mutual understanding and self-responsibility
- Promotes systemic change, equity, and transformation?

This two-day circle supports those new to and experienced in Restorative Justice facilitation and Circle Keeping. Together, we will experience and deepen in the consciousness and power of Restorative Practices that build trust and relationship as well as address harm and injustice. The practices we are sharing are rooted in Nonviolent Communication, Restorative Circles, and Community-Building/Talking Circles in the Peacemaking Circle tradition.

We welcome individuals and groups working to cultivate Restorative and Compassionate Culture, reverse systems of oppression, and establish or enhance community-based Restorative Practices and Restorative Justice.
